Capacity for weight

A high-end electric chair is made to support more weight than a regular power chair. Also known as bariatric powerchairs they are able to maneuver through tough terrain. They feature a bigger frame as well as more powerful motors and a better suspension than other models. Some models are able to take on slopes that are up to 10 degrees, which is more than twice the height of ramps with ADA compliance. They are often more expensive than other types of power wheelchairs, but they are worth the investment in case you want to keep moving.

Battery life

A long battery life is among the most important characteristics of electric wheelchairs. It allows users to do errands, explore the surroundings visiting friends and family and take part in activities that keep them entertained without worrying about running out of small power chair. The good news is that manufacturers are constantly striving to extend the battery longevity of their wheelchairs. They can accomplish this by making the batteries lighter and using them more effectively. For instance, they can use lithium-ion batteries that hold more energy than traditional lead-acid ones. They can also create motors that are more efficient and reduce friction. This allows the battery to travel farther on a single charge.

The life of batteries is also affected by other factors, such as the speed and terrain. The more you drive your wheelchair, the faster it will lose energy. It is best to use it on smooth, hard surfaces. The more weight you carry in your wheelchair, and the greater strain the battery will be under the greater strain, the quicker it will deplete.

A long-lasting battery is dependent on regular maintenance and charging. The best method to maintain the health of your battery is to avoid letting it reach a deep discharge state, which could dramatically decrease the lifespan of the battery. To avoid this, it's best to regularly recharge the battery at a normal temperature and keep it in a cool place. It's also crucial to examine the battery terminals for corrosion and ensure that they're properly lubricated.
